Comprehensive Health Planning Council Priority Needs of McKinley County (2007)
  • Poverty and income inequity
  • Institutional racism
  • Multigenerational trauma

Community Environmental Health Concerns
  • Solid waste/ trash
  • Water quality/ quantity waste water disposal
  • Environmental institutional racism
  • Ambient air quality/dust, fumes, road work
  • Animal/ livestock control

HSC Activities in McKinley County (2007)

Education

  • 27 UNM SOM student &/or resident grads practicing in county (UNM SOM Location Report ‘07)
  • 6 Current med students graduated from high schools in county
  • 2 Current BA/MD student graduated from high school in county (Gallup)
  • 22 Current nursing students graduated from high schools in county
  • 5 Current pharmacy students graduated from high schools in county
  • 23 Student/resident months supported by Area Health Education Center
  • 138 Emergency Medical Services grads from the county (4 Ctr. for Disaster Med mbrs.)
  • 4 Months med student Community Immersion Experience w/ community preceptor
  • 3 Months med student Preceptorship w/ community preceptor
  • 23 Hours of training/technical assistance, Ctr. For Developmental Disabilities (FY07)

Services Provided to County

  • 378.8 Primary care Locum Tenens coverage days provided in 2007
  • 124.8 Specialty Extension Services days provided in 2007
  • 699 calls to the New Mexico Poison Center in FY07
  • 5 Center for Disaster Medicine Emergency/Preparedness Trainings in county
  • 1 First Aid Station or Emergency Medical Services Standby provided by Ctr. for Disaster Medicine
  • 37 Lifeguard Air Emergency Transports to UNMH in 2007
  • 36 County residents seen at Pediatric Neurology outreach clinics in 2007 (Gallup)
  • 276 Hours of client services, Ctr. For Developmental Disabilities (FY07)
  • Department of Psychiatry / Center for Rural & Community Behavioral Health:

    • 56 Hours Behavioral Health Research and Evaluation with Native American communities in 2007

    • 146 Hours Behavioral Health training, education and consultation for Native American communities in 2007

    • 88 Hours Child & Adolescent Psychiatry services provided to county residents in 2007

    • 56 Hours Child & Adolescent Telepsychiatry consults in 2007

    • 8 Hours Native American Behavioral Health training, education and consultation provided to county residents in 2007
  • 247 County residents served at UNM Cancer Research & Treatment Center (FY07)
  • 5,538 total McKinley County patient visits at UNM Hospitals and Clinics (FY07):
    • 1,156 Charity Care
    • 1,482 Uninsured
    • 4,056 Compensated Care
  • $1,535,958 in uncompensated costs for care to McKinley County residents (FY07)
